Output 98650deba10342d966543ba7ff396cb5ea205f7c5863e4a65b936f53a765f20a:0

value
37900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 294b5558fdd233640e1d0c589a4e844eb746a890 OP_EQUALVERIFY OP_CHECKSIG
address
14mLx7zziGAX7qyfcnaSSBzLLsJrX8xTyK
transaction
98650deba10342d966543ba7ff396cb5ea205f7c5863e4a65b936f53a765f20a
spent
true